#include "../../reowolf.h"
#include "../utility.c"
int main(int argc, char** argv) {
char msgbuf[64];
// ask user what message to send
size_t msglen = get_user_msg(msgbuf, sizeof(msgbuf));
// Create a connector, configured with our (trivial) protocol.
Arc_ProtocolDescription * pd = protocol_description_parse("", 0);
char logpath[] = "./pres_1_amy.txt";
Connector * c = connector_new_logging(pd, logpath, sizeof(logpath)-1);
rw_err_peek(c);
// ... with 1 outgoing network connection
PortId p0;
char addr_str[] = "127.0.0.1:8000";
connector_add_net_port(c, &p0, addr_str, sizeof(addr_str)-1,
Polarity_Putter, EndpointPolarity_Passive);
rw_err_peek(c);
// Connect with peers (5000ms timeout).
connector_connect(c, 5000);
rw_err_peek(c);
// Prepare a message to send
connector_put_bytes(c, p0, msgbuf, msglen);
rw_err_peek(c);
// ... reach new consistent state within 1000ms deadline.
connector_sync(c, 1000);
rw_err_peek(c);
printf("Exiting\n");
protocol_description_destroy(pd);
connector_destroy(c);
sleep(1.0);
return 0;
}
